Walmart and Wing Take Flight: A Massive Expansion in Drone Delivery

For years, the concept of packages arriving by air, lowered gently onto our doorsteps by autonomous aircraft, felt like a distant futuristic dream. While companies like Amazon and Google's parent company, Alphabet, have been experimenting with drone delivery for some time, the reality has often been confined to small-scale pilots and limited geographic areas. However, a recent announcement from retail giant Walmart and Alphabet's drone subsidiary, Wing, signals a significant shift, pushing this futuristic vision closer to mainstream adoption. The two companies are embarking on a dramatic expansion, planning to bring drone delivery services to 100 additional Walmart stores across five major US metropolitan areas within the next year.

This ambitious rollout targets bustling regions including Atlanta, Georgia; Charlotte, North Carolina; Houston, Texas; Orlando, Florida; and Tampa, Florida. The scale of this expansion is unprecedented in the US, promising to extend the reach of rapid aerial delivery to millions of potential customers. If successful, this initiative could fundamentally alter consumer expectations for speed and convenience in online shopping, particularly for small, urgent purchases.

Building on Success: Lessons from Dallas-Fort Worth

The foundation for this large-scale expansion was laid over nearly two years in the Dallas-Fort Worth area. There, Wing has been operating drone delivery services for a handful of Walmart locations, providing valuable insights into the operational realities, customer behavior, and logistical challenges of aerial last-mile delivery. The Dallas pilot has served as a crucial testing ground, allowing Walmart and Wing to refine their processes and technology.

According to Adam Woodworth, CEO of Wing, the Dallas operation currently involves 18 stores, each equipped with 18 drones. This setup enables them to handle approximately 1,000 orders per day. The average delivery time in this region is a remarkable 19 minutes from the moment a customer clicks 'checkout' to the package being lowered at their location. This speed is a key differentiator for drone delivery, offering a level of immediacy that traditional ground-based methods struggle to match.

The types of items most frequently ordered via drone in Dallas provide a glimpse into the immediate use cases for this technology. Baby wipes and eggs are among the top deliveries, highlighting the convenience for essential, frequently needed items. Beyond these staples, customers also utilize the service for those spontaneous needs – a forgotten ingredient for a recipe, a pint of milk for a child, or perhaps a small item that saves a trip to the store. The drones used by Wing are fixed-wing aircraft with a five-foot wingspan, capable of carrying packages weighing up to 5 pounds. At most stores, Wing workers are responsible for picking, packing, and deploying the drone orders, integrating the aerial service into existing store operations.

The pricing structure in Dallas has varied. Some areas have access to a broad selection of items with a $20 delivery fee, which is waived for members of Walmart's $98-a-year Walmart+ program. However, a more limited selection of items, generally priced the same as in-store, is available to all customers for free delivery when ordered through Wing's dedicated app. In the initial phases of the new expansion cities, only this latter option – ordering a limited selection through the Wing app for free delivery – will be available, suggesting a cautious, phased approach to market entry.

The Promise and the Peril: Analyzing Commercial Viability

Despite the excitement surrounding this expansion, the path to widespread, profitable drone delivery is far from guaranteed. Critics and industry experts remain skeptical about the commercial viability of routine drone deliveries in the near future. Matthias Winkenbach, who directs research at the MIT Center for Transportation & Logistics, is among those who doubt its profitability. He points to several significant hurdles:

  • Regulatory Complexity: Navigating the patchwork of regulations from the Federal Aviation Administration (FAA) and local municipalities is a time-consuming and costly process. While the FAA has made strides in authorizing commercial drone operations, obtaining permissions for widespread, routine flights over populated areas remains complex.
  • High Operational Costs: Employing trained drone pilots and maintenance staff, managing battery life, and maintaining a fleet of sophisticated aircraft are expensive endeavors. These costs need to be offset by delivery fees or increased sales volume.
  • Unpredictable Environments: Unlike deliveries to controlled environments, delivering to customers' homes involves navigating varied landscapes, potential obstacles (trees, power lines), and the unpredictable behavior of people and pets.
  • Competition with Traditional Logistics: As Winkenbach notes, it's challenging to beat the efficiency and price point of established ground-based delivery networks like UPS or FedEx, especially for larger or less urgent orders.

Wing CEO Adam Woodworth declined to comment on the specifics of Wing's business model, stating that financial arrangements differ across delivery partners. Wing is involved in various partnerships globally, including with DoorDash in Australia and the UK's National Health Service for transporting medical supplies. Generally, Wing envisions a future where it earns revenue by taking a cut of the delivery fee for each transaction. This model suggests that the success of drone delivery hinges on either customers being willing to pay a premium for speed and convenience or the operational costs decreasing significantly over time.

Navigating the Airspace: Public Perception and Safety Concerns

Beyond the economic equation, public acceptance and safety are critical factors for the success of drone delivery. While Walmart's previous drone deployments, including partnerships with Zipline and the now-shuttered DroneUp, have reportedly met with little protest in areas like Dallas and northwest Arkansas, other companies have faced pushback.

Amazon's Prime Air pilot in College Station, Texas, for instance, faced significant complaints from neighbors. Residents voiced concerns about noise pollution, potential surveillance by the drones, and the impact on local wildlife. Amazon temporarily suspended deliveries in Texas and Arizona following incidents where drones fell from the sky during test flights in December. Although no one was hurt in these incidents, and Amazon is still operating in Texas and Arizona with planned launches in other cities, such events highlight the public's sensitivity to aerial activity over their homes.

Wing's drones are reportedly lighter than those used by Amazon, and Woodworth claims that neighbors of Walmart stores will find it difficult to even spot them in the sky. He acknowledged a "handful" of precautionary landings in "preferred" safe spots like trees during the Dallas service but described them as "largely non-events." Woodworth asserts that the company's drones are "inherently safe" and that early architectural decisions have resulted in high operational reliability. However, public perception can be heavily influenced by isolated incidents, regardless of overall safety records.

Another operational consideration is weather. It's no coincidence that the chosen expansion cities are in relatively warm and temperate climates. Drones do not perform dependably in extreme weather conditions, such as high winds, heavy rain, or snow. Very cold temperatures can also impact battery performance, requiring drones to be warmed up. Woodworth confirmed that service is faster and more reliable in places with better weather, indicating that climate will remain a limiting factor for drone delivery in certain regions or seasons.

The Regulatory Landscape and Future Prospects

Drone operations in the US are primarily regulated by the Federal Aviation Administration (FAA). Wing has been actively working with municipalities in the expansion areas to establish the necessary infrastructure and clarify operational parameters. In April, the FAA authorized Wing to conduct a significant number of daily deliveries in the Dallas and Charlotte regions, granting permission for flights from 7 am to 10 pm, with potential for up to 30,000 deliveries daily in Dallas and 10,000 in Charlotte. These authorizations are crucial steps, demonstrating regulatory progress and a willingness from the FAA to enable scaled drone operations under specific conditions.

This expansion represents a bold move by Walmart to stay competitive in the rapidly evolving e-commerce landscape. With Amazon continuously pushing the boundaries of delivery speed and convenience, Walmart is leveraging partnerships like the one with Wing to offer differentiated services. Greg Cathey, a Walmart innovation executive, stated that drone delivery is a "key part of our commitment to redefining retail." This suggests that Walmart views drone delivery not just as a novelty, but as a strategic component of its future logistics network, potentially enhancing the value proposition of its Walmart+ membership and attracting customers seeking ultimate convenience.

The success of this large-scale test will provide invaluable data on customer adoption rates, operational efficiency at scale, cost-effectiveness, and the public's long-term reaction to widespread drone activity. It will also highlight the specific logistical challenges of integrating drone operations into existing retail infrastructure across diverse urban and suburban environments.

The Competitive Landscape: More Than Just Walmart and Wing

The drone delivery space is not exclusive to Walmart and Wing. As mentioned, Amazon continues its efforts with Prime Air, albeit facing its own set of challenges. Other players are also active. Zipline, which partnered with Walmart in the Dallas area, focuses heavily on medical deliveries but is also exploring retail logistics. Companies like DoorDash are integrating drones into their existing delivery networks in certain markets. The competition is fierce, and the technology is rapidly advancing.

The expansion into five new major markets positions Walmart and Wing as leaders in the US drone delivery race in terms of geographic reach and potential customer base. However, the ultimate winner will likely be determined by which company can most effectively overcome the significant hurdles of cost, regulation, public acceptance, and operational reliability at scale.

The types of items suitable for drone delivery are currently limited by weight and size constraints (Wing's 5-pound limit). This makes it ideal for small, high-value, or urgent items rather than a full grocery haul or large electronics. The economic model needs to make sense for these specific use cases. Free delivery for limited items via the Wing app in the new markets suggests an initial focus on driving trial and gathering data, potentially subsidized by Walmart or Wing as an investment in future logistics capabilities.

Looking Ahead: The Future of Aerial Logistics

The expansion to 100 stores is more than just adding locations; it's a critical test of scalability. Can Wing and Walmart replicate the relative success seen in Dallas across diverse regulatory environments, population densities, and weather patterns? The operational complexity increases significantly with more stores, more drones, and a larger service area.

The data gathered from Atlanta, Charlotte, Houston, Orlando, and Tampa will be crucial. It will inform decisions about further expansion, pricing strategies, service offerings, and the long-term viability of drone delivery as a mainstream logistics option. It will also provide valuable feedback to regulators like the FAA as they continue to develop the framework for integrating unmanned aircraft systems into the national airspace.

While a future where all our online orders arrive by drone is still a long way off, Walmart and Wing's massive expansion is a significant step forward. It moves drone delivery out of the realm of niche pilots and into the daily lives of millions of Americans. The coming year will be a critical period for this technology, demonstrating whether it can truly become a commercially viable, publicly accepted, and reliable method for last-mile delivery, or if it will remain a supplementary service for specific items and situations.
